随着网络的普及和发展,网站已经成为现代社会中不可或缺的基本组成部分。不论是商业网站、社交媒体还是个人博客,高效的页面加载速度和流畅的用户体验对于各种类型的网站都至关重要。如何检查网站的页面加载速度和性能优化,让用户更加愉悦地浏览我们的网站呢?
一、为什么需要检查网站的页面加载速度和性能优化?
网站的页面加载速度是用户体验的重要组成部分,它关系到用户是否能够保持兴趣,并促进他们在网站上继续浏览的时间长度。而用户的继续浏览时间长度则是衡量网站网页质量的一个重要指标。因此,保持快速的页面加载速度,对于网站的流量和用户体验来说至关重要。
同时,一个快速加载的网站也有助于提高搜索引擎排名。搜索引擎在排名时会考虑网站的加载速度,因为快速加载的网站能够提供更好的用户体验,而优质的用户体验将被搜索引擎记在心中,因此排名也相应提高。
考虑到这些因素,网站开发者应该极为重视网站的页面加载速度,并进行性能优化。
二、如何检查网站的页面加载速度?
1.使用浏览器开发者工具检查页面加载速度
大多数现代浏览器都具有开发者工具,可以用来监视页面的加载速度,包括各种资源(图片、样式、脚本等)。在浏览器中按下F12键,进入开发者工具界面,然后按下网络选项卡即可查看页面加载速度。
使用浏览器开发者工具,我们可以看到每个资源的加载时间,包括它们的大小、请求次数和响应时间等信息。这样可以帮助我们发现哪些资源或组成元素导致了加载速度的下降,以便取进一步进行优化。
2.使用在线工具来检测页面加载速度
此外,有很多在线工具可以用来测试和分析网站的页面的加载速度,例如PageSpeed Insights、GTmetrix、WebPageTest。这些工具可以分析网站的性能瓶颈,并提供优化建议。
三、如何进行性能优化?
1.压缩图片
图片通常是网站中占用带宽最大的元素之一。因此,图片的优化可以明显提高页面加载速度。压缩图片的方法很多,可以减小图片文件的大小,而不影响其质量。有很多在线工具和图形编辑软件可供选择,例如TinyPNG、ImageOptim、Photoshop等。
2.使用缓存
缓存可以显著提高网站的性能。缓存的主要原理是浏览器在第一次访问网站时,会将某些资源(如CSS、JS和图片)缓存在本地,以便在下一次访问时直接从本地获取。这样,即使资源来自不同的URL,浏览器仍然可以快速地从本地获取,而不需要重新获取资源。
3.减少HTTP请求次数
HTTP请求次数的增多,是导致页面加载时间延长的主要原因之一。优化HTTP请求次数的方法之一是将所有脚本和样式集成到一个文件中,以减少请求次数。另一种方法是使用CSS Sprites,将多张小图片合并成一张大图片,减少HTTP请求次数。
4.使用CDN
CDN (Content Delivery Network) 是一组分布在全球各地的服务器,可以帮助加速网站的内容分发。用CDN分发的网站文件都会被缓存到CDN服务器上。当用户请求网站时,CDN服务器会根据用户的地理位置,带宽大小等因素来选择最合适的服务器。这样可以显著提高网站的访问速度。
5.在服务器层面进行优化
我们可以在服务器层面进行一些优化,以提高网站性能。一种方法是使用压缩程序,例如gzip,可以将HTML、CSS和JavaScript压缩到更小的文件中,减少带宽的使用。另一个方法是缓存响应,可以在服务器上定义文件缓存时间,以减少对服务器的请求负载。
6.使用HTML5新特性
HTML5是为互联网而设计的,具有更快的加载速度和更丰富的功能。它支持多媒体和图像标签,可以减少网站在加载多媒体内容时的请求次数。而且,HTML5还具有本地存储和离线访问功能,让网站更加可靠和高效。
在我们的日常工作中,以上的这些优化技术和工具可以帮助我们检查网站的页面加载速度和性能,提高用户满意度和搜索引擎排名。通过优化网站的性能,我们可以确保网站能够更快地加载,并提供更好的用户体验。